It's a piece of sneaker history you can wear daily. However — and this is important — the comfort level won't win any awards. If you prioritize plush, all-day comfort, "look elsewhere". This is for style and heritage first, comfort second. Just keeping it 100% real with you all. Let's talk "pros". The biggest advantage of this "black Air Jordan 1" is its sheer versatility. It's a blank canvas for outfits. The build is durable, & it hides creases & scuffs better than any light-colored shoe. For $190, you're getting a timeless design that won't go out of style. It's a workhorse in sneaker form. On foot now. The fit is true to size for me – good, snug lockdown around the midfoot. But let's be real, the comfort? It's a classic AJ1. The cushioning is firm; you're not getting Boost or React here. The black Air Jordan 1 is more about style than all-day comfort. It's a bit heavy, but that's part of the iconic feel. On feet, this all-"black colorway" is incredibly versatile. It goes with literally everything—cargo pants, jeans, shorts. The matte finish doesn't look cheap in person; it has a subtle, sleek look that works for casual fits. Compared to a brighter "Jordan 1", this is your go-to, low-key flex. It's a wardrobe staple, no doubt.
